Independent testing certifies clean credentials of BlueOptimize25 November 2015

Engine remapping business Viezu has announced that its BlueOptimize remapping service has been independently verified for emissions reductions at a VCA-approved facility.

BlueOptimize was tested on a standard 2013 Ford Transit 2.2 tdci to the New European Drive Cycle (NEDC) test. The results, says Viezu, showed that with engine remapping, the vehicle emitted 17% less NOx and fuel consumption was also lowered.

Linda Busby, Viezu’s managing director, says the independent test was sought to give fleet customers confidence in BlueOptimize’s capabilities, particularly given the recent emissions scandal and the High Court ruling in April on air quality.

Viezu’s software engineers develop bespoke engine maps for every vehicle, taking into account the typical drive cycle, load and other key characteristics.

The engine map is then modified to introduce factors such as rev or throttle limiting to ensure that performance is improved, without any detrimental impact on the environment.

“Real world testing carried out by both ourselves and our customers have shown even more significant improvements,” adds Busby.

“However, now we are pleased to be able to back this up with certified data which confirms the environmental and fuel-saving possibilities available with BlueOptimize.”
